Architectural Style Explorations

Traditional Irish Character

Celtic design elements: Incorporate traditional Celtic motifs and design elements creating authentic Irish character.

Stone and timber combinations: Traditional materials and construction methods reflecting Irish building heritage.

Thatched roof interpretations: Modern interpretations of traditional thatched roofing providing character while meeting contemporary needs.

Cottage garden integration: Designs that complement traditional Irish cottage garden styles and planting.

Contemporary Minimalist Approaches

Clean geometric lines: Simplified forms emphasizing proportion and material quality over decorative elements.

Industrial material integration: Steel, glass, and concrete creating sophisticated contemporary outdoor spaces.

Seamless indoor-outdoor connections: Design elements that blur boundaries between interior and exterior living spaces.

Technology integration: Smart systems and modern conveniences integrated discretely within contemporary design.

Victorian and Period Inspirations

Ornate decorative details: Traditional Victorian gingerbread and decorative elements adapted for outdoor structures.

Conservatory styling: Glass and iron combinations creating elegant garden room aesthetics.

Historical accuracy considerations: Appropriate period details for heritage properties and conservation areas.

Modern comfort integration: Contemporary conveniences integrated sensitively within period design frameworks.

Cost Considerations and Investment

Custom Design Investment Levels

Basic custom features: €15,000-30,000 for modest customization of standard designs Comprehensive custom design: €30,000-75,000 for extensively customized structures Luxury custom gazebos: €75,000-200,000+ for elaborate custom designs with premium features
